News summary

The quantum computing industry is gaining momentum, with significant investments and advancements in technology, positioning several cities as potential new tech hubs. Tech giants like IBM, Google, and Microsoft, along with smaller firms, have invested heavily in quantum hardware and software, leading to a projected $1 trillion contribution to the global economy over the next decade. However, practical applications of quantum computing are still hindered by challenges such as the fragility of qubits, which limits their reliability for real-world use, particularly in IoT applications. Researchers are exploring multi-level 'qudits' as a more efficient alternative to qubits, potentially enhancing computational capabilities. Additionally, the vision for a quantum internet is emerging, promising secure communication and advanced applications that classical systems cannot provide. Despite the excitement surrounding quantum breakthroughs, standardized testing and validation are needed to ensure these technologies can achieve reliable performance.
